Transaction 295e63c80c883a3603beb9d27de84136ad0f768fc710ee407115ca0dd88e77e8

2 Input
2 Outputs
  • 295e63c80c883a3603beb9d27de84136ad0f768fc710ee407115ca0dd88e77e8:0
  • value  357030
    address  1DS9urAeqRx9BaZZcwN1pwmeHbMFcC15By
  • 295e63c80c883a3603beb9d27de84136ad0f768fc710ee407115ca0dd88e77e8:1
  • value  1281362
    address  39VAxzXAgB6FKwwyxD2eN73ReSMTULN3En